## Step 4: Enable fan-out backpressure

Before promoting Larkspur Notify v9, switch the fan-out workers to the bounded queue mode. Without it, a burst from the Coppervale digest job can starve downstream consumers and delay pages. The change is config-only; no restart ordering matters. Apply the following values to each worker group.

deployment values, kadup-fafop:
[fenael]
port = 8000
region = lower-3
host = fenael.sivrelcloud.internal
team = wenwyn
timeout_ms = 2000
retries = 8

## Onboarding: Fareweight Rules Engine

Fareweight computes shipping fees from stacked rule sets. Rules are versioned; never edit a live version. Deploys go through the staging evaluator first. Read the rule DSL guide before touching anything.

Rule definitions live in the pricing database — connect to it with the connection string below.

primary connection of yagep-bajop = postgresql://druiel_svc:gW@db-3860.sivrelworks.example:5432/brieth

Subject: Incremental rebuild ownership change

Hello plugin authors,

Ownership of the incremental static rebuild pipeline in Stonegrove is transferring to a new maintainer. The plugin hook API (`onPartialBuild`, cache invalidation callbacks) is unchanged for now; a deprecation notice will precede any future changes. Please direct compatibility questions, bug reports, and proposals for new rebuild hooks to the maintainer identified below.

account owner for bawip-tahag: Raleth Quenok